Output 3a8bb4d31456d72cb0e05ccae0df9ea955bf6dc52256e90f41af497bdbce2ef8:1

value
89039266
script pubkey
OP_0 OP_PUSHBYTES_20 ef63be37e67adb4ae201225434ca1739cb8244d2
address
ltc1qaa3mudlx0td54cspyf2rfjsh889cy3xjxprdwz
transaction
3a8bb4d31456d72cb0e05ccae0df9ea955bf6dc52256e90f41af497bdbce2ef8
spent
true